BlackRock reports 5.7% Globant (GLOB) stake with 2.45M shares owned

Globant S.A. reported that BlackRock, Inc., through certain of its business units, holds a significant passive ownership position in Globant’s common stock. As of June 30, 2026, BlackRock beneficially owned 2,450,809 shares of common stock, representing 5.7% of the outstanding class.

BlackRock had sole voting power over 2,400,487 shares and sole dispositive power over 2,450,809 shares, with no shared voting or dispositive power. Various underlying clients or investors have rights to dividends or sale proceeds, but no single underlying holder has more than five percent of Globant’s outstanding common shares.

Beneficially owned describes securities or assets where a person has the economic rights and control—such as the right to receive dividends and to direct voting—even if legal title is held in another name. Think of it like having the keys and using a car that’s registered to someone else: you get the benefits and make decisions. Investors care because beneficial ownership reveals who truly controls value and voting power, affecting corporate decisions and takeover dynamics.

Sole voting power is the exclusive right to cast votes attached to a shareholder’s stock without needing approval from anyone else. Like holding the only remote control for a TV, it lets that holder decide corporate matters such as board members, mergers, and policy changes, making it important to investors because it concentrates control and can strongly influence a company’s strategy and the value of its shares.

Sole dispositive power is the exclusive legal authority to decide what happens to a security — for example, whether to sell, transfer, or retain shares — without needing anyone else’s permission. Investors care because it signals who truly controls the economic outcome of an investment: like holding the only key to a safe, the holder can realize gains or losses and may trigger regulatory reporting, insider rules, or influence over corporate ownership.
